Sha256: 2d1f107512695bd2daf7fcc6aabb60d8d148a8e02be9b7d2a9ead1b50f2e705b

Contents?: true

Size: 290 Bytes

Versions: 1

Compression:

Stored size: 290 Bytes

Contents

# code: utf-8

require 'thor'
require 'thor/aws'

module AwsAccountNumber
  class CLI < Thor
    include Thor::Aws

    desc :get, "get AWS Account Number"
    def get
      puts ec2.client.describe_security_groups(group_names: ['default']).security_groups.first.owner_id
    end
  end
end

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
aws_account_number-0.1.0 lib/aws_account_number/cli.rb